Hydrogenated Castor Oil (HCO) has a very wide use in the industries like: Lubricants, Paper Coatings, Processing Aids, Polishes, Investment Castings, Inks, Pencil & Crayons, Cosmetics, Electrical Applications, Hot Melt Adhesives.

DESCRIPTION SPECIFIC RANGE
Appearance White Flake
Colour Gardner Max 3 (Gardner)
Colour Apha 750 Max
Colour Lovibond 5 ¼ â?? Cell 20 Yellow Max, 2 Red Max
Acid Value % (mgKoH/gm) Max 3
Iodine Value gI2 /100g Max 3
Hydroxyl Value (mgKoH/gm) 155 Min
Saponification Value 174 -186
Melting Point º C 84º C
Unsaponifiable Matter 1.0 Max
Nickel PPM 3 - 5 PPM
12 Keto Stearic Acid 4 Max
12 HSA % 83 â?? 87
Particle Size 98% Passing through 16 Mesh
Flash Point ºF 585º F Min (Cleveland Open Cup)
Metal Catalyst 20 PPM Max

Hydrogen gas is passed through Refined castor oil with Nickel as to get Hydrogenated Castor Oil. After filtration, the liquid HCO goes either to Flaking machine to get HCO Flakes or to Spray Drying Tower to get HCO Powder.
